Michael Bay Filmmaking Style And Brand Power 2019
By 2019, Michael Bay was synonymous with big-budget, effects-driven action cinema. His emphasis on practical stunts, elaborate set pieces, and high marketing spend consistently delivered box office returns that justified substantial guarantees and backend participation.
Brands continued to seek him for high-impact commercials, leveraging his reputation for spectacular visuals. This demand reinforced his earning power beyond film budgets into lucrative endorsement and production fees.
Box Office Trajectory Leading Into 2019
In the years preceding 2019, Bay alternated between tentpole sequels and new IP launches. While some releases faced critical pushback, they generally performed well internationally, maintaining strong franchise value for investors and talent partners.
The performance of Transformers: The Last Knight in 2017 and the continued cable, streaming residuals kept his projects in the revenue pipeline. This trajectory sustained interest from financiers and reinforced reliable income forecasts for 2019.
Business Ventures And Production Impact
Through Platinum Dunes, Michael Bay remained deeply involved in producing horror and genre projects alongside his directing work. The company retained ownership stakes in several successful films, creating long-tail earnings through licensing and distribution deals.
His structuring of profit participation and rights helped convert moderate box office into substantially larger returns over time, a practice that defined his net worth trajectory into 2019.
